  • HYVINKÄÄ, Finland
Pekka Lundmark took over from Stig Gustavson as president and CEO of KCI Konecranes in June this year. Forkliftaction.com News finds out more about the new chief of the global crane and forklift manufacturer that has 4,900 employees in 35 countries. (KCI Konecranes manufactures 10-60 ton (9-54 tonne) forklifts and reach stackers through SMV Konecranes.)

  • XIAMEN, China
Linde-Xiamen Forklift Truck Co Ltd has changed its name to Linde (China) Forklift Truck Corp Ltd, as part of Linde Group's strategy to expand its reach in the Chinese market.

  • SACRAMENTO, CA, United States
The California Air Resources Board has indefinitely postponed its consideration of a rulemaking proposal for off-road large spark ignition engines.

  • WICHITA, KS, United States
A forklift was left running inside Burnham Composites Inc last week, resulting in 10 people visiting the Wesley Medical Centre for carbon monoxide poisoning.

  • MELBOURNE, Australia
There are 85,000 forklifts in Victoria, Australia. This month, WorkSafe Victoria inspectors will visit 500 large and small workplaces in their latest safety campaign.
